  SA 2592. Mr. HEINRICH (for himself and Mr. Cornyn) submitted an 
amendment intended to be proposed to amendment SA 2137 proposed by Mr. 
Schumer (for Ms. Sinema (for herself, Mr. Portman, Mr. Manchin, Mr. 
Cassidy, Mrs. Shaheen, Ms. Collins, Mr. Tester, Ms. Murkowski, Mr. 
Warner, and Mr. Romney)) to the bill H.R. 3684, to authorize funds for 
Federal-aid highways, highway safety programs, and transit programs, 
and for other purposes; which was ordered to lie on the table; as 
follows:
        On page 2585, line 5, insert ``Provided further, That the 
     Administrator shall use not less than $25,000,000 of the 
     amounts made available under this paragraph in this Act in 
     each of fiscal years 2022 through 2026 to provide wastewater 
     assistance under section 307

[[Page S5974]]

     of the Safe Drinking Water Act Amendments of 1996 (33 U.S.C. 
     1281 note; Public Law 104-182) to eligible communities (as 
     defined in subsection (a) of that section):'' after 
     ``1383):''.
       On page 2587, line 3, insert ``Provided further, That the 
     Administrator shall use not less than $25,000,000 of the 
     amounts made available under this paragraph in this Act in 
     each of fiscal years 2022 through 2026 to provide drinking 
     water assistance under section 1456 of the Safe Drinking 
     Water Act (42 U.S.C. 300j-16) to eligible communities (as 
     defined in subsection (a) of that section):'' after ``300j-
     12):''.
